An adventure to Galápagos with HX, through an agent’s eyes
Liza Royce from The Personal Travel Agents shares how an HX fam trip changed the way she saw the Ecuadorian archipelago
Did the Galápagos Islands exceed your expectations? Absolutely, although I was initially apprehensive about the distance and my fitness. With HX, you have two nights in Quito, which helped with recovering from jet lag before the cruise. The activities catered for all fitness levels; I’m in my mid-50s and found them comfortable. There were choices for different abilities, and I coped well with the most challenging ones.
What wildlife experiences did you have? Within the first hour of our first rib boat ride we saw manta rays, blue-footed boobies, sea lions and iguanas. We thought we had peaked too early, but the days just got better as we spotted giant tortoises, albatrosses, frigate birds, pelicans and finches. We swam with sea
lions, turtles, rays and sharks. We even spotted a whale breaching while we were relaxing in the hot tub!
What activities did you do?
Every night there was an expedition briefing for the next day’s activities, which
are all included. We snorkelled almost daily and enjoyed walks around the islands. We cycled, kayaked, went stand-up paddleboarding and visited sanctuaries and local farms. There were also daily talks from the Expedition Team and we took part in Citizen Science projects.
What did you think of the ship? It was ideal. It wasn’t too big and all the cabins were well furnished and comfortable. The all-inclusive, locally inspired food included breakfasts, buffet lunches and à la carte dinners. Free snacks in the lounges encouraged everyone to mix and share experiences. One evening we watched the sun set with barbecue nibbles and cocktails.
